The Gateway NX860XL doesn't really game well and it's battery life is nothing to brag about. This may sound like a bad thing until you consider it in the light of a desktop replacement for work as opposed to a gaming machine. [H]ard|OCP likes what they received from Gateway, from the product itself to the Tech Support, and call this notebook a winner.
"We were impressed by Gateway's NX860X notebook back in August 2006, so we decided to order the updated XL version with all the
trimmings to see what this gaming laptop can do. Though it's not as fancy as some notebooks from other integrators, it offers
more bang for the buck than any notebook we've evaluated."
